Product Overview

Category:

P4KE120A B0G belongs to the category of transient voltage suppressor diodes.

Use:

It is used to protect electronic circuits from overvoltage transients.

Characteristics:

  • Fast response time
  • Low clamping voltage
  • High surge capability

Package:

The P4KE120A B0G is available in a DO-41 package.

Essence:

The essence of P4KE120A B0G lies in its ability to quickly divert excessive current away from sensitive components, thereby safeguarding them from damage.

Packaging/Quantity:

It is typically packaged in reels or bulk quantities, depending on the supplier.

Specifications

  • Peak Pulse Power: 400W
  • Breakdown Voltage: 108V to 132V
  • Maximum Clamping Voltage: 174V at 1A
  • Operating Temperature Range: -55°C to +175°C

Working Principles

When an overvoltage transient occurs, the P4KE120A B0G conducts current and clamps the voltage to a safe level, protecting downstream components.
